What is certificate handshake?

SSL Handshake Explained

SSL follows a handshake process that sets up a secure connection without disturbing customers’ shopping experience. The SSL handshake process is as under: Both parties agree on a single cipher suite and generate the session keys (symmetric keys) to encrypt and decrypt the information during an SSL session.

Furthermore, how do I disable TLS handshake? Disable TLS Handshake on Firefox (Old versions)

  1. Go to the Firefox menu and click on Options.
  2. Now, click on the Advanced tab and then click on Encryption.
  3. Uncheck Use SSL 3.0 and Use TLS 1.0 instead.
  4. Once done click on the OK button and restart Firefox.

Likewise, what is a TLS handshake?

A TLS handshake is the process that kicks off a communication session that uses TLS encryption. During a TLS handshake, the two communicating sides exchange messages to acknowledge each other, verify each other, establish the encryption algorithms they will use, and agree on session keys.

How does a certificate work?

SSL certificates have a key pair: a public and a private key. These keys work together to establish an encrypted connection. This process creates a private key and public key on your server. The CSR data file that you send to the SSL Certificate issuer (called a Certificate Authority or CA) contains the public key.

What is 3 way handshake protocol?

A three-way handshake is a method used in a TCP/IP network to create a connection between a local host/client and server. It is a three-step method that requires both the client and server to exchange SYN and ACK (acknowledgment) packets before actual data communication begins.

What is https mean?

Hypertext Transfer Protocol Secure

What is the difference between SSL and TLS?

SSL refers to Secure Sockets Layer whereas TLS refers to Transport Layer Security. Basically, they are one and the same, but, entirely different. How similar both are? SSL and TLS are cryptographic protocols that authenticate data transfer between servers, systems, applications and users.

What are the 3 steps in a TCP handshake?

To establish a connection, the three-way (or 3-step) handshake occurs: SYN: The active open is performed by the client sending a SYN to the server. SYN-ACK: In response, the server replies with a SYN-ACK. ACK: Finally, the client sends an ACK back to the server.

How do you fix SSL handshake failure?

It’s not a big deal though, here’s how to fix SSL connection errors on Android phones. Let’s Start with SSL/TLS Certificates. 1.) Correct the Date and Time on your Android Device. 2.) Clear Browsing Data on Chrome. 3.) Change WiFi Connection. 4.) Temporarily Disable Antivirus. 5.) Reset your Android Device.

How does 2 way SSL work?

Two-way ssl means that a client and a server communicates on a verified connection with each other. The verifying is done by certificates to identify. A server and a client has implemented a private key certificate and a public key certificate.

How long does SSL handshake take?

This handshake will typically take between 250 milliseconds to half a second, but it can take longer. At first, a half second might not sound like a lot of time. The primary performance problem with the TLS handshake is not how long it takes, it is when the handshake happens.

What is pre master secret?

The Pre-Master Secret The pre-master key is the value you directly obtain from the key exchange (e.g. gab(modp) g a b ( mod p ) if using Diffie-Hellman). Its length varies depending on the algorithm and the parameters used during the key exchange.

What is master secret in SSL?

Overview# In TLS, the Master Secret is the Symmetric Key used for Encryption between the Protocol Client and Protocol Server.[1] For all Key-Exchange methods, the same algorithm is used to convert the Premaster Secret into the Master Secret.

How do I find my TLS certificate?

Click the Security Tab, Select “View Certificate” The Security tab is all the way to the left, find it and select “View Certificate.”

What is TLS used for?

TLS is a cryptographic protocol that provides end-to-end communications security over networks and is widely used for internet communications and online transactions. It is an IETF standard intended to prevent eavesdropping, tampering and message forgery.

What is TLS and how it works?

TLS is a cryptographic protocol that provides end-to-end security of data sent between applications over the Internet. It is mostly familiar to users through its use in secure web browsing, and in particular the padlock icon that appears in web browsers when a secure session is established.

How do you make a pre master secret?

The pre-master secret is created by the client (the method of creation depends on the cipher suite) and then shared with the server. Before sending the pre-master secret to the server, the client encrypts it using the server public key extracted from the certificate provided by the server.

How do I exchange my encryption key?

In encrypted key exchange, a secret key, or password, is derived from one party’s public key and another party’s private key. The shared secret key is then used to encrypt subsequent communications between the parties, who may have no prior knowledge of each other, using a symmetric key cipher.